Transaction 43ab78f91d4153038f0fd5607a69d4c7e91e12ffaf22017349a207f5038156b5

2 Input
2 Outputs
  • 43ab78f91d4153038f0fd5607a69d4c7e91e12ffaf22017349a207f5038156b5:0
  • value  435000000
    address  14zEphoHB5PX4x6bBchzYAyaWrNZJFwKBy
  • 43ab78f91d4153038f0fd5607a69d4c7e91e12ffaf22017349a207f5038156b5:1
  • value  7880000
    address  1EVK1e1LP4bsM1CnJ2wmqdGx5Xdi7ur4C5